Use Strong Security Measures
When gambling online, your security should always be a top priority. Using strong passwords, enabling two-factor authentication, and ensuring that the gambling site employs encryption technologies such as SSL (Secure Sockets Layer) are fundamental measures for online security. By using SSL encryption, you ensure that any sensitive data, such as payment details and personal information, is transmitted securely. Always make sure the platform you’re using provides clear information about its security protocols. Gambling securely requires attention to detail, so don’t hesitate to check the website’s security features before proceeding with any transactions.
Practice Responsible Gambling
Responsible gambling is a vital aspect of online safety. This involves setting limits on the amount of time and money you spend gambling. Many platforms offer tools to help you control your gambling habits, including setting daily, weekly, or monthly deposit limits. If you’re new to online gambling, it’s essential to start small and gradually build your experience. By practicing responsible gambling, you ensure that you’re always in control and able to stop whenever you feel the need. With growing concerns about gambling addiction, adopting responsible gambling practices should be a fundamental part of your approach.
Choose Safe Payment Methods
When making deposits or withdrawals, always opt for safe, secure, and trusted payment methods. Credit and debit cards, e-wallets, and bank transfers are commonly used methods, but ensure that the platform you’re using offers these options with robust encryption and fraud prevention measures. Some gambling platforms even allow for cryptocurrency transactions, offering additional privacy for those who prefer not to disclose personal financial information. Regardless of the method, it’s critical to choose options that guarantee the safety of your funds and the integrity of your transactions.
